Columbus, Ohio, July 3 – GS Finance Corp. priced $2.73 million of 0% autocallable underlier-linked notes due July 2, 2021 based on the performance of the Euro Stoxx 50 index and the iShares MSCI EAFE exchange-traded fund, according to a 424B2 fil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.
The notes are guaranteed by Goldman Sachs Group, Inc.
The notes will be automatically called at par plus an 11.25% annualized call premium if both components close at or above their initial levels on any annual call observation date.
If the notes are not called and both components finish at or above their initial levels, the payout at maturity will be $1,450 per $1,000 principal amount.
If both components finish below their initial levels but the return of each component is at least negative 30%, the payout will be $1,100 per $1,000 note.
If the return of either component is less than negative 30%, the payout will be par plus the return of the lesser performing component, with full exposure to losses.
Goldman, Sachs & Co. is the agent.
